Regulators do not like the idea of mobile markets dominated by three carriers, preferring the number of four. So it is that Telefonica's proposed €8.6bn purchase of E-Plus, the German arm of The Netherlands' KPN, which would create Germany's largest cellco, is getting close scrutiny.
That likely will be an issue for Sprint as well.
